Republican Sen. Eric Schmidt, of Missouri, is confronting Eventbrite over its “progressive liberal agenda to silence and depublish occasions that categorical conservative views,” after Eventbrite pulled tickets for Riley Gaines’ talking tour that it claimed didn’t adjust to its group pointers. .

In a letter to Eventbrite CEO Julia Hartz on Friday, Schmidt questioned the ticketing platform’s causes for eradicating the Gaines occasion from its web site.

Schmidt additionally accused the platform of hypocrisy in claiming that Gaines’ occasion violated its “group pointers and phrases of service,” whereas persevering with to advertise anti-Israel protests throughout the nation.

“It’s value noting that whereas the sort of content material is eliminated out of your platform, different occasions that includes people who’ve expressed strongly anti-Semitic views, evaluating Israel to Nazi Germany, and different distinguished supporters of the BDS motion towards Israel are permitted to host or “converse at occasions listed on Eventbrite,” the Republican senator wrote.

Whereas Gaines’ occasion has been faraway from Eventbrite, ticket gross sales for anti-Israel protests stay lively, corresponding to “Tempest NYC,” an upcoming occasion calling for “Cease Genocide! Free Palestine!”

In search of extra details about the method of eradicating an occasion, Schmidt requested Eventbrite to offer “an entire record of occasions that Eventbrite has not revealed as a result of a violation of its Phrases of Service and the explanation these occasions had been unpublished.”

The senator additionally requested “an entire record of organizations which have hosted an occasion on the Eventbrite platform.”

Schmidt requested whether or not the occasion administration web site offers the general public the power to report occasions and whether or not Eventbrite takes these complaints into consideration when selecting to take away occasions.

Gaines’ first cease on her faculty tour in November to advocate for girls’s rights in sports activities is scheduled to be on the College of California, Davis. Details about the “Defending Girls’s Sports activities with Riley Gaines” occasion was listed on Eventbrite till it was pulled Tuesday.

“By permitting pro-terrorism and anti-Semitic teams to maintain their occasions scheduled on the Eventbrite platform, however canceling occasions that debate the significance of making certain security, justice, and equal alternatives for girls, Eventbrite has despatched a transparent message to everybody. Eventbrite is setting the instance,” Gaines advised Fox Information Digital after studying of the occasion’s removing. “Organizations that take a stand towards girls and our fundamental human rights.”

“If endorsing girls in girls’s sports activities is inherently transphobic, then endorsing trans girls in girls’s sports activities is inherently anti-women,” Gaines beforehand mentioned in a press release despatched to Fox Information Digital. That is the place Eventbrite has taken. The occasion shall be held at UC Davis “Subsequent month. My speech is not going to be stifled.”

In accordance with Eventbrite Belief & Security, the occasion violated the corporate’s “Group Pointers and Phrases of Service.”

“We have now decided that your occasion just isn’t permitted on the Eventbrite Market as a result of it violates our Group Pointers and Phrases of Service, which all customers comply with abide by,” Eventbrite wrote.

“Particularly, we don’t allow content material or occasions that – by exercise on or off the Platform – discriminate towards, harass, disparage, threaten, incite, or in any other case goal people or teams based mostly on their race, ethnicity, or precise ancestry.” or perceived faith, nationwide origin, immigration standing, gender id, sexual orientation, veteran standing, age, or incapacity.

“Because of this, your occasion has been unpublished. Please remember that extreme or repeated violations of our pointers could lead to suspension or termination of your Eventbrite account.”
